Architecture
Govern your architecture
Architecture tests, ratchets and capability boundaries enforce structure mechanically — not in a wiki nobody reads.
How it helps
Ratcheted invariants
Property tests fail the build when hardcoded values or cross-layer imports creep in.
Capability boundaries
Domain-grouped packages with declared owners and scopes keep coupling low.
Three-tier lifecycle
active / stub / incubator keeps dead concepts out of CI without losing the idea.
Powered by
FAQ
- Does governance slow teams down?
- It moves review from humans to tests, so most checks are instant and automatic.